What Is Cybersecurity?

Cybersecurity is the practice of protecting computer systems, networks, and sensitive information from unauthorized access, theft, damage, or other malicious attacks. It involves a set of technologies, processes, and practices designed to safeguard digital assets from cyber threats and ensure their confidentiality, integrity, and availability.


The scope of cybersecurity is broad and encompasses a variety of domains, including but not limited to:


Information security: protecting sensitive data, such as personal information, financial records, and intellectual property, from unauthorized disclosure, alteration, or destruction.

Network security: securing the infrastructure that connects computers and devices, such as routers, switches, and firewalls, to prevent unauthorized access and ensure data confidentiality and integrity.

Application security: securing the software and applications that run on computer systems and networks, such as web browsers, email clients, and database servers, to prevent exploitation of vulnerabilities and unauthorized access.

Cloud security: securing the data and applications that are stored and accessed over the internet, such as cloud storage, software-as-a-service (SaaS), and platform-as-a-service (PaaS) offerings.

Cybersecurity threats can come from a variety of sources, including cybercriminals, hackers, state-sponsored actors, insiders, and even accidental or unintentional actions by employees or users. These threats can take many forms, such as malware, phishing attacks, social engineering, ransomware, and denial-of-service (DoS) attacks, among others.


To mitigate these threats, cybersecurity professionals use a variety of tools and techniques, such as firewalls, antivirus software, intrusion detection and prevention systems (IDPS), encryption, access controls, and security awareness training for employees and users. They also follow established best practices and standards, such as the National Institute of Standards and Technology (NIST) Cybersecurity Framework, to ensure a comprehensive and effective cybersecurity posture.


Why Is Cybersecurity Important?

Cybersecurity is an essential aspect of modern-day life. As technology advances and more people rely on digital devices, the risk of cyber threats increases. Cybersecurity is crucial because it protects individuals, businesses, and governments from cyber attacks that can cause significant damage.


One of the most significant reasons why cybersecurity is important is because it helps prevent data breaches. A data breach can occur when hackers gain unauthorized access to sensitive information, such as personal data, financial information, or intellectual property. Data breaches can result in financial losses, legal liabilities, and reputational damage. Cybersecurity measures, such as firewalls, encryption, and multi-factor authentication, can help prevent data breaches by making it more difficult for hackers to gain access to sensitive information.


Cybersecurity is also important because it helps protect critical infrastructure. Critical infrastructure refers to the systems and assets that are essential for the functioning of society, such as power grids, transportation systems, and healthcare facilities. A cyber attack on critical infrastructure can have devastating consequences, including power outages, transportation disruptions, and even loss of life. Cybersecurity measures, such as intrusion detection systems, network segmentation, and disaster recovery plans, can help protect critical infrastructure from cyber threats.


Finally, cybersecurity is important because it helps protect individual privacy. With the increasing amount of personal information being shared online, it is essential to ensure that this information is protected from cyber threats. Cybersecurity measures, such as strong passwords, two-factor authentication, and anti-virus software, can help protect individual privacy by preventing unauthorized access to personal information.
